The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of William Sharpson, born in 1814 in Bolton, Lancashire, consisted of 6 members. William was the head of the household, married to Sarah C Sharpson, born in 1823 in Salisbury, Wiltshire, England. They had 3 children; Elizabeth (born 1860 in Farnham, Surrey, England), Emily (born 1860 in Farnham, Surrey, England) and Walter (born 1864 in Farnham, Surrey, England).
During the period, also present in the household was William's Nurse Child, William R Emett, born in 1880 in Aldershot, Hampshire, England.
